Factors Impacting the Cost of Building Auto Parts Inventory Management Software Like Shopmonkey
The cost of developing auto parts inventory management software is based on several factors. The following factors help you identify where possible expenditures are likely to occur, and based on that, you can plan a budget before starting on development work.
1. Main Features and Functions
The number of features and their complexity impact the cost. Simple inventory tracking is easier, but if you want advanced features like automatic reorder alerts, supplier management, and tracking part compatibility, you need more time and skill to develop them.
Key Features That Your Auto Parts Inventory Management Software Should Have:
- Inventory Tracking: Real-time inventory verification between warehouses/sites
- Order Management: Prompt processing of customer and supplier orders
- Supplier Management: Track suppliers, deliveries, and lead times
- Parts Compatibility: Ensure that parts are compatible with the vehicle model and its specific needs.
- Notifications and Alerts: Low stock, order pending, or recall alerts.
2. Deployment Model
The deployment model also determines upfront and recurring costs. Cloud solutions minimize hardware expenditure and enable subscription models. On-premise installations require server hardware and IT staff, and are hence more costly upfront.
3. Technology Stack and Mobile Support
Language, framework, and platform choice affect programmer rates and development time. Systems that are field- and workshop-team-friendly add complexity but are increasingly a requirement for auto parts inventory management software for the modern automotive market.

5. Customization & Scalability
Applications designed for a particular job and constructed for expandability are costly. Specialized parts, sophisticated automation, and adaptable design require additional coding and testing, but ensure the system expands along with the business.
6. Security & Compliance
Inventory systems handle sensitive business and customer information. That’s why it requires adequate security controls and compliance with standards like GDPR. Introducing encryption, access controls, and regulatory compliance adds complexity to the development process.
7. Integration of POS and ERP Systems
A seamless connection with POS, accounting, and ERP systems helps ensure accurate inventory and order management. Every connection makes things more complicated, needing special APIs or middleware, which raises costs and testing work.
8. User Experience and Reporting
Good interface design enhances adoption and efficiency. Tailored dashboards, analytics, and real-time reporting enable managers to monitor inventory, orders, and sales trends easily. Advanced UI/UX design enhances development and testing time.
9. Testing and Maintenance
With proper testing, the software performs steadily on sites and devices. Maintenance involves fixing bugs, upgrading, and providing technical support. Extensive testing and technical support for a lifetime are expensive, but they are a requirement for long-term functionality.

Estimated Cost Breakdown for Auto Parts Inventory Management Software
| Factors
| Basic ($)
| Mid-Level ($)
| Enterprise ($) |
|---|
| Core Features
| 5,000 - 10,000
| 10,000 - 20,000
| 20,000 - 30,000
|
| Deployment Model | 1,000 - 3,000
| 3,000 - 6,000
| 6,000 - 10,000
|
| Technology Stack
| 2,000 - 5,000
| 5,000 - 10,000
| 10,000 - 15,000
|
| Development Team
| 8,000 - 15,000
| 15,000 - 25,000
| 25,000 - 40,000
|
| Customization
| 3,000 - 6,000
| 6,000 - 12,000
| 12,000 - 20,000
|
| Security & Compliance
| 1,000 - 3,000
| 3,000 - 6,000
| 6,000 - 10,000
|
| Integration | 2,000 - 5,000
| 5,000 - 10,000 | 10,000 - 15,000
|
| User Experience
| 1,000 - 3,000
| 3,000 - 6,000
| 6,000 - 10,000
|
| Testing & Maintenance
| 2,000 - 5,000
| 5,000 - 8,000
| 8,000 - 12,000
|
Estimated Total Cost:
- Basic Tier: $25,000 – $45,000
- Mid-Level Tier: $50,000 – $85,000
- Enterprise Tier: $90,000 – $150,000
Best Practices to Stay In Budget while Building an Auto Parts Inventory Management System
Sometimes, even after deciding on a budget development cost, it increases. Now, let’s discuss some best practices that help you stay on budget and avoid wasting money on unnecessary things.
- Clearly List Primary Requirements:
Determine the key features and functionalities beforehand. Never create irrelevant functionalities in the initial stages, as they slow down timelines and increase costs.
- Select Scalable Solutions: Select an architecture that scales with your business. This will enable you to start with the core features and scale later, with initial expenditures kept low.
- Choose the Right Technology Stack: Select a robust and cost-effective technology that is easy to work with. Eliminate highly sophisticated frameworks that require extensive development time and expense.
- Utilize Cloud Deployment: Cloud deployment minimizes infrastructure expense and offers scalable pricing. It also makes maintenance and future updates easier.

- Implement in Phases: Begin small with a Minimum Viable Product (MVP) and incrementally release features. It enables testing, gathering user feedback, and spending under control.
- Ongoing Monitoring and Optimization: Regularly track budget, progress, and resource usage. Adjust work priorities and workflows as needed to prevent overrunning and maintain the project’s efficiency.
